Dr. Chad Thomas Department Chair of English, English Associate Professor, English Contact 1310 Ben Graves DriveMorton HallRoom 278HHuntsville, AL 35899 Campus Map 256.824.6323chad.thomas@uah.edu Biography Dr. Chad Thomas is the Chair of English and an Associate Professor of Shakespeare and dramatic literature at the University of Alabama in Huntsville. He is the co-founder and co-artistic director of Huntsville Shakespeare and a former director of the Women’s, Gender, and Sexuality Studies Program. His teaching encompasses English, Theatre, and Women’s, Gender, and Sexuality Studies, reflecting his interdisciplinary approach to literature and performance. As both a scholar and practitioner, Dr. Thomas explores the intersections of gender, spectatorship, and performance, with a particular focus on cross-gender casting in Shakespeare’s works. His research has appeared in Shakespeare Bulletin, Comparative Drama, Theatre Topics, 1650-1850, and the Cambridge University Press collection Shakespeare on the Campus Stage. In addition to his scholarship, he has professional credits as a producer, director, actor, and dramaturge, dedicated to using innovative staging to challenge cultural narratives and expand how audiences experience Shakespeare.
